The BD53E41G is a CMOS Voltage Detector IC from ROHM Semiconductor, designed for high accuracy and low current consumption. It features an adjustable delay time controlled by an external capacitor, making it suitable for applications requiring precise timing and reset functions. The device operates within a detection voltage range of 4.1V, with a typical current consumption of 0.95µA. It is packaged in a compact SSOP5 format, measuring 2.90mm x 2.80mm x 1.25mm, which is advantageous for space-constrained designs. The BD53E41G is ideal for circuits utilizing microcontrollers or logic circuits that necessitate reliable reset signals.
ROHM's BD52Exxx and BD53Exxx series are highlyaccurate, low current consumption Voltage DetectorICs with a capacitor controlled time delay. The line upincludes BD52Exxx devices with N-channel open drainoutput and BD53Exxx devices with CMOS output. Thedevices are available for specific detection voltagesranging from 2.3V to 6.0V in increments of 0.1V.
